The Brisbane German Club is a delightful destination for anyone craving authentic German cuisine and a warm, welcoming atmosphere. With a history dating back to 1883, this establishment has been bringing the best of Germany to Brisbane for over a century.
One of the standout features of the Brisbane German Club is its commitment to providing an authentic experience. From the moment you step inside, you'll be transported to Germany with traditional German food and beverages that are sure to satisfy even the most discerning palate. Whether you're craving bratwurst, schnitzel, or sauerkraut, you can trust that the dishes here are prepared with care and attention to detail.
In addition to the delicious food, the Brisbane German Club also offers live entertainment on Friday and Saturday nights. This adds an extra layer of excitement and enjoyment to your dining experience, making it a perfect place for a night out with friends or family.
The club itself boasts impressive facilities including a bar, poker machines, members lounge, restaurant, and a beer/dance hall. This means there's something for everyone here, whether you're looking for a casual drink at the bar or a lively night of dancing.
Membership options are available for those who want to fully immerse themselves in all that the Brisbane German Club has to offer. Social membership is just $5 for two years (valid until December 2020), allowing you access to all the club's amenities as well as exclusive events. Full membership is also available at $44 per year and comes with additional perks such as a 10% discount on drinks at the bar and voting rights within the club.
